==Education== ===Primary and secondary=== <!-- section linked from [[Penygaer school]] --> The first [[Welsh language|Welsh]]-medium [[primary school]], [[Ysgol Dewi Sant (Llanelli)|Ysgol Gymraeg Dewi Sant]], was founded in Llanelli in 1947. The English-medium [[secondary school]]s are [[St John Lloyd Catholic Comprehensive School|St John Lloyd]], [[Bryngwyn Comprehensive School|Bryngwyn]] and [[Coedcae School|Coedcae]]; the only Welsh medium secondary school is [[Ysgol y Strade]]. [[St Michael's School, Llanelli|St Michael's School]] is a [[Public school (UK)#England, Wales and Northern Ireland|private school]] for ages 3β18. Ysgol Heol Goffa is a [[special school]] for pupils with disabilities. ===Further and higher education=== [[Coleg Sir GΓ’r]] (Carmarthenshire College), with its main campus at Graig near Pwll, provides a college education for most of the town's further education students and some vocational undergraduate degrees through the [[University of Wales]]. There are [[sixth form]] colleges at Ysgol Gyfun y Strade (Welsh medium) and St Michael's (English medium). Prince Philip Hospital has a postgraduate centre for medical training run by [[Cardiff University]]'s School of Postgraduate Medical and Dental Education.<ref>[http://www.cardiff.ac.uk/pgmde/pg_centres/postgrad_llanelli.htm Llanelli Postgraduate Centre] {{webarchive |url=https://web.archive.org/web/20041001132211/http://www.cardiff.ac.uk/pgmde/pg_centres/postgrad_llanelli.htm |date=1 October 2004}} test</ref>
